About Éric Ouellet

Éric Ouellet is a scholar working on Molecular Biology, Sociology and Political Science, Biomedical Engineering, Political Science and International Relations and Electrical and Electronic Engineering, having authored 31 papers that have together received 464 indexed citations. Recurring topics across this work include Advanced biosensing and bioanalysis techniques (7 papers), RNA Interference and Gene Delivery (5 papers), Military History and Strategy (3 papers), Microfluidic and Capillary Electrophoresis Applications (3 papers), Biosensors and Analytical Detection (3 papers), Multiculturalism, Politics, Migration, Gender (3 papers), Advanced Biosensing Techniques and Applications (3 papers) and Advanced Fiber Optic Sensors (2 papers). The work is most often cited by research in Filtration and Separation (10 citations), Biomedical Engineering (198 citations), Molecular Biology (198 citations), Electrical and Electronic Engineering (163 citations) and Surfaces, Coatings and Films (19 citations). Éric Ouellet has collaborated with scholars based in Canada, United States and Mexico. Frequent co-authors include Eric T. Lagally, Cheng Wei Tony Yang, Tao Lin, Charles A. Haynes, Leroy Hood, Christopher Lausted, Edward M. Conway, Jonathan H. Foley, Karen C. Cheung and Samantha M. Grist. Their work appears in journals such as Biotechnology and Bioengineering, Small Wars and Insurgencies, Lab on a Chip, Molecular Therapy and Armed Forces & Society.
